Things to do in Berlin?Berlin, MD is a charming small town located in the heart of Maryland’s Eastern Shore. The community is filled with plenty of places to explore including a number of antique shops and unique boutiques, as well as a range of restaurants and entertainment venues. Residents can also enjoy outdoor activities at nearby parks and beaches, or relax in one of the many historical sites that span across the area including the renowned Assateague Island National Seashore. Despite its close proximity to larger cities such as Baltimore, DC, and Annapolis, Berlin remains quaint and calm while still having plenty of opportunities for fun. With its friendly people and scenic views, it’s easy to understand why living in Berlin is so enjoyable.
